cloud verb. LME.
[from the noun.]
I. verb trans.
Overspread or darken with clouds, gloom, trouble, etc.; throw into the shade, surpass; make dim or obscure; mar, detract from; arch. defame. LME.
Hide, conceal. L17-E18.
Variegate with vague patches of colour. L17.
clouded leopard a large, spotted, mainly arboreal feline, Neofelis nebulosa, of SE Asia. clouded yellow an orange or yellow and black pierid butterfly of the genus Colias, esp. C. croceus, known in Britain as a migrant from southern Europe.
II. verb intrans.
Become overcast or gloomy. (Foll. by over, up.) M16.
